11.2 Radio interface wireless M-Bus (optional)
The radio interface is for the transmission of meter data (absolute values).
General information about the radio interface
When installing the radio components, avoid metallic material directly in front of the housing.
The transmission quality (range, telegram processing) of radio components can be negatively influenced by
instruments or equipment with electromagnetic emissions, such as telephones (particularly LTE mobile radio
standard), wi-fi routers, baby monitors, remote control units, electric motors, etc.
In addition, the construction of the building has a strong influence on the transmission range and coverage.
The factory-setting of the internal clock inside the heat cost allocator is standard (winter) Central European
Time (GMT +1). There is no automatic changeover to daylight savings (summer) time.
The radio function is deactivated upon delivery (see 11.2.6 “Activation of the radio interface”)
